Care and Cleaning

Swan products are stain and wear resistant; however,
the finish requires reasonable care.

Because cleaning products change over time, always
check the manufacturer’s instructions to make sure it is
compatible with plastic. DO NOT use a cleaner if the
label indicates it should not be used on plastics. DO NOT
use spray-on cleaners that require daily use without
immediately rinsing with water to stop the chemical
cleaning reaction because damage will result and void the
warranty.

Day-To-Day Cleanup

Simply wipe the surfaces with a clean towel to remove
watermarks and residues. Swan Corporation ADA
Barrier-Free Shower Floors can be cleaned with warm
water, a soft cloth, and normal (nonabrasive) household
detergents or cleansers, such as Fantastic, Formula
409, Clorox Clean-up, Handy Andy, Mr. Clean, or Lestoil.
Always rinse off cleaners within five minutes of
application.

If necessary, use a nonabrasive cleaner with a nylon
brush or pad to remove build-up on the shower floor
surface. Do Not use abrasive cleansers, steel wool, or
a wire brush. This will damage the surface.

Caulking Joints

If silicone caulking was applied after installation of the
wall panels or tile, inspect the caulking joints monthly for
damage or any signs of separation from the mating
surface. Cracks in the caulking will allow water to leak
into the surrounding surfaces. Reapply caulking to
any joint showing signs of wear or cracking.
Failure
to inspect and repair caulking joints will void the
warranty.
